| description | As artificial intelligence becomes pervasive, therapists might be left wondering about its
implications for narrative practice. This paper explores an unexpected discovery about the power
of artificial intelligence in re-imagining a story of injustice. Lucy (the therapist) and Miles (the
client) used an AI image creator to assist in the externalisation of problems. Creating imagery
representing Miles’s story of injustice and sharing the images with outsider witnesses became
acts of justice and healing. The process of narrative justice using AI has implications for the
practice of narrative therapy. This article finishes with an opportunity for readers and viewers to
respond to Miles’s online gallery of imagery. |
